Sheets as a category encompass a range of fabrics, thread counts, and weaves designed to influence comfort, hygiene, and sleep quality. Understanding variations between cotton, sateen, and blends helps compare breathability, softness, and durability. The right sheet set can support temperature regulation, moisture management, and overall bed cleanliness for daily living.
In the realm of organic and premium fabrics, satin and sateen finishes offer distinct hand feels and luster. Organic cotton sateen sheets typically balance smoothness with durability, while maintaining fabric purity and lower environmental impact. Knowledge of weave structure assists in predicting how sheets wear over time and respond to washing cycles.
